present ui position fix

This commit is contained in:
2026-03-08 02:35:42 +01:00
parent 3eccedfad4
commit 56d6b262ff

View File

@@ -143,29 +143,29 @@ const copyCodeToClipboard = async () => {
</div> </div>
</div> </div>
<div v-if="sessionStore.connectedUsers.length" class="participants-panel"> <div class="toolbar-footer">
<div class="property-label">Participants ({{ sessionStore.connectedUsers.length }})</div> <div v-if="sessionStore.connectedUsers.length" class="participants-panel">
<div class="participants-list"> <div class="property-label">Present ({{ sessionStore.connectedUsers.length }})</div>
<div <div class="participants-list">
v-for="user in sessionStore.connectedUsers" <div
:key="user.userId" v-for="user in sessionStore.connectedUsers"
class="participant" :key="user.userId"
> class="participant"
<span
class="participant-avatar"
:style="{ backgroundColor: avatarColorFromString(user.username || user.userId) }"
> >
{{ (user.username || '?').charAt(0).toUpperCase() }} <span
</span> class="participant-avatar"
<span class="participant-name"> :style="{ backgroundColor: avatarColorFromString(user.username || user.userId) }"
{{ user.username || 'Unknown' }} >
<span v-if="user.userId === auth.user?.userId" class="you-label">(You)</span> {{ (user.username || '?').charAt(0).toUpperCase() }}
</span> </span>
<span class="participant-name">
{{ user.username || 'Unknown' }}
<span v-if="user.userId === auth.user?.userId" class="you-label">(You)</span>
</span>
</div>
</div> </div>
</div> </div>
</div>
<div class="toolbar-footer">
<div class="position-relative mb-2"> <div class="position-relative mb-2">
<button <button
class="btn btn-sm btn-outline-primary w-100" class="btn btn-sm btn-outline-primary w-100"
@@ -279,9 +279,9 @@ const copyCodeToClipboard = async () => {
} }
.participants-panel { .participants-panel {
margin-top: 12px; margin-bottom: 12px;
border-top: 1px solid #2a2a3e; border-bottom: 1px solid #2a2a3e;
padding-top: 10px; padding-bottom: 10px;
} }
.participants-list { .participants-list {